It is clear from the book that the island is situated in the South Pacific,
i.e. in Oceania with modern terms for the
continents.
Elias Granqvist, 20 Nov 2010
Quoting an English language translation at Project Gutenberg, Lincoln
Island, as it was called, was at «Longitude 150° 30′ west;
latitude 34° 57′ south».
